Output fb3862392c1b64fc7a46ef61c5cdb4a9439aa80e1aeb9d06521a01a75ad3a20b:0

value
2834528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f83d05700c3e1de6c91c6a48f15d8a6abf1264 OP_EQUAL
address
3MvgdqoQkQgyijb2suvjoNUHNpE6rFMPqE
transaction
fb3862392c1b64fc7a46ef61c5cdb4a9439aa80e1aeb9d06521a01a75ad3a20b
spent
true